Compatibility With Espresso Models

Verifying compatibility with your specific espresso machine model is vital for maintaining peak performance and avoiding frustrating malfunctions. Many parts, like filter baskets, are designed to fit only certain brands or series, such as 51mm or 54mm filters. So, I always check part numbers and dimensions before making a purchase. It's surprising how even slight variations, like the thickness of a filter basket or the length of silicone tubes, can impact fit and function.

Some components, including portafilters and steam rings, are tailored to match the pressure and brewing requirements of particular machines. This makes compatibility essential for peak performance. I often look for parts that meet O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turer) specifications, which helps guarantee that they'll work as intended with my machine.

Additionally, I find user reviews to be incredibly valuable. Customer feedback can provide insights into how well replacement parts fit different models, helping me make informed decisions. By focusing on compatibility, I can guarantee my espresso machine runs smoothly and delivers that perfect cup every time. Maintenance and Replacement Frequency

Regular maintenance is vital for keeping my espresso machine in top shape, and understanding the replacement frequency of its parts can save me both time and money. Many components, such as filter assemblies and tubes, typically require replacement every 1-2 years due to wear and clogging. I've learned that filter baskets might need more frequent changes if they become clogged or damaged from improper handling or cleaning.

Silicone tubes used for frothing can degrade over time, so I keep an eye on them for blockages or loss of flexibility. As for sealing components like steam rings, I aim to replace those every 5 years; it's essential for peak performance and preventing leaks.

I've also noticed that the lifespan of espresso machine parts largely depends on how frequently I use the machine. If I'm brewing espresso daily, I'll need to replace parts more often compared to a machine that sits idle most of the week. By staying proactive about maintenance and replacements, I can make certain my espresso machine continues to deliver delicious coffee while avoiding costly repairs down the line.

How Do I Know When to Replace My Espresso Machine Parts?

I always look for signs that my espresso machine parts need replacing. If I notice a decline in coffee quality, like weak or bitter flavors, it's usually time for a change. I also check for leaks or unusual noises during operation. When the machine shows inconsistent temperatures or takes longer to brew, that's another red flag. Keeping an eye on these indicators helps me maintain my machine and guarantee I get the best coffee experience.

What Are the Signs of a Malfunctioning Espresso Machine?

When my espresso machine starts acting up, I look for a few telltale signs. If it's making strange noises, leaking, or the coffee tastes off, I know something's wrong. I also pay attention to any error messages displayed or if the machine takes longer than usual to brew. If the steam wand isn't producing steam or the pressure gauge isn't reading right, I realize it's time to investigate further or call for help.
